转自:http://www.xuebuyuan.com/1102224.html

这个问题一直困扰我很久,Python对缩进很敏感,一般建议缩进用空格,而 Notepad++的自动缩进是用的TAB,google过,baidu过,都提到在首选项中有个将TAB用4个空格代替的选项,可我一直找不到这个选 项,经过N个版本更新后依然如初,甚至还下载过一些插件希望能解决,但无果。

今天终于在帮助文档中找到答案了(HELP很重要啊!!!),特记录之,免日久又忘掉。

如果你想打开自动缩进,可以在 设置-》首选项-》其他 中进行设置

勾选了这个后,你换行是就会自动缩进了,下面还要设置将TAB更换成4个空格
设置-》首选项-》语言-》标签设置

不要改“Default”,现在做得很灵活了,可以对不同的语言进行设置,我们可以选上Pyhton,将默认去掉,选“以空格取代”

现在你的Notepad++可以很好的编辑Pyhton文件了

随便说说运行的设置,在运行(F5)中输入 cmd /k
C:\Python26\python.exe "$(FULL_CURRENT_PATH)" & PAUSE & EXIT
,点击保存,自己起个名字,以后在“运行”菜单下就可以运行你的Python程序

最新文章

  1. 深入分析Java ClassLoader原理
  2. 用Python生成组织机构代码,附源码
  3. 转大写字母-(ASCII表)
  4. Media PLayer
  5. [string]字符串中几个比较难的算法和容易搞混的题目
  6. ajax跨域请求学习笔记
  7. SQL Server2012中的SequenceNumber
  8. Spring MVC的核心流程(步骤)
  9. [ 10.4 ]CF每日一题系列—— 486C
  10. liunx安装nginx
  11. H+ 显示并激活menuTab 根据tabName
  12. Kubernetes容器上下文环境
  13. [ovs] openvswitch 入门
  14. p1473 Zero Sum
  15. Styles in Windows Phone
  16. HDU 4035 Maze 概率DP 搜索
  17. 获得硬盘的ID序列号(XE10.1+WIN8.1)
  18. swift swift学习笔记--函数和闭包
  19. redis的sort排序
  20. 扫描线 - UVALive - 6864 Strange Antennas

热门文章

  1. memory leak at strcore.cpp
  2. mysql开发中使用存储过程
  3. 第二篇 SQL Server安全验证
  4. Java IO读取文件之二
  5. Jquery点击表格单位时选中其中的Radio的三个方法
  6. OSPF理解
  7. 来自“Java中国”优秀的程序员不会觉得累成狗是一种荣耀
  8. 原来现在很多人都用SignalR来实现Chat Room
  9. javascript 函数参数之中的undefined(zz)
  10. 如何在RedHat6(7) or CentOS6(7)上制作无依赖的PostgreSQL数据库的RPM包